Thai Peanut sauce

This recipe is fantastic over a deep fried fish. We brought this very fish pictured here to my mom's Christmas party and the family loved it!! In a blender combine: 1 tbls patis ½ cup peanut butter ¼ cup seasoned rice vinegar Juice of 1 lg lime ¼ cup brown sugar 2 thai bird chilis if you like it hot or 2 diced, seeded jalapenos ¼ cup chopped cilantro 2 teas sesame oil 2 lg cloves garlic crushed 2 shallots roughly diced ½ cup or more coconut milk(not the syrup kind for mixed drinks) Pluse the blender until all ingredients puree together adding coconut milk as needed. Lightly warm in a sauce pan being careful not to boil. Check for seasoning adding more patis, lime or sugar as needed. Wonderful dish serve with the fish or your choice!!! Bon Appetit!
